The United States officially recognizes four primary time zones in the continental region. These include Eastern Standard Time, Central Standard Time, Mountain Standard Time, and Pacific Time (PT). Each time zone represents a one-hour difference, helping to standardize time across the country.
Beyond the mainland, the US also includes additional time zones. Alaska Time and Hawaii Standard Time are used in the westernmost states. These time zones are several hours behind Eastern Time, making it especially important to check the correct local time when scheduling meetings.
Daylight Saving Time plays a significant role in US time zones. Most states adjust their clocks forward in spring and return to standard time in the fall.
